Network tube radiosDomesticRadiola network lamp "Symphony-003" has been produced since 1971 at the Riga Radio Engineering Plant. The top-class stereophonic radio "Symphony 003" is developed on the basis of the "Symphony-2" radio, but differs from it. The electrical circuit has been improved, new materials for decoration have been applied, a push-button range switch, a more advanced EPU type II-EPU-52S with hitchhiking has been used. The receiver has the ranges DV, SV, KV 1-4 and VHF. Sensitivity in AM ranges - 30, FM - 2.5 μV. Selectivity 60 dB. The band of reproducible frequencies in the AM ranges 40 ... 7000 Hz, FM and when playing records 40 ... 15000 Hz. The power amplifier is made on 6P14P lamps, switched on according to an ultra-linear circuit with auto-bias, and has an output power of 2x4 W. Speakers are three-way, closed type, each has 6GD-2, 3GD-1 and 1GD-3 loudspeakers. The dimensions of the speakers are reduced in comparison with those used in the Symphony 2 radio. Due to the high sensitivity of the speaker heads, it develops a sound pressure of 112 dB at a distance of 1 m, with a power input of 4 W. Power consumption with EPU 130 W. Dimensions of the radio 795x525x375 mm, weight 37 kg. Dimensions of one speaker 790x350x285 mm, weight 14.5 kg. In 1976, a small series of "Symphony-003M" radiolabels was released, which practically did not differ from the basic one. The export radio, produced since 1971, was called Rigonda-Bolshoi, it had other frequencies in the VHF range and HF subbands and all, respectively. the inscriptions were in English.
